A sweet and nutty aroma. Pours black in the glass. Starts very sweet and sticky, with sour milky lactose in the background. On the finish you do have some dry and earthy nutty notes, but I'm not getting anything distinctive enough to be walnut or pistachio. I think that the icing sugar sweetness in there is just so intense that it takes over all the other flavours. A bit too sweet for me, but does hide the abv well.
